Groundworks is seeking a talented Distribution Manager to join our tribe in Columbia, SC!
The Distribution Manager at Groundworks is responsible for overseeing the efficient and timely distribution of foundation repair materials, equipment, and products to support our field operations nationwide. To be a contributing member of the team, this role enables the organization to develop by optimizing logistics, inventory management, and distribution processes that ensure seamless supply chain operations. The Distribution Manager plays a key role in maintaining Groundworks’ reputation for reliability, quality, and customer satisfaction by ensuring that our branches and job sites receive the right products at the right time.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Manage all aspects of distribution center operations including receiving, storage, inventory control, order fulfillment, and shipping.
- Develop and implement distribution strategies that improve efficiency, reduce costs, and support Groundworks’ rapid growth and service excellence.
- Coordinate logistics and transportation to ensure timely delivery of materials and equipment to Groundworks branches and job sites.
- Monitor inventory levels and collaborate with procurement and manufacturing teams to maintain optimal stock availability.
- Lead, train, and develop distribution center staff to foster a high-performance, safety-conscious team environment.
- Ensure compliance with safety regulations, company policies, and quality standards within the distribution operations.
- Utilize warehouse management systems (WMS) and other technology tools to track inventory and streamline distribution workflows.
- Analyze distribution metrics and KPIs to identify opportunities for process improvements and cost savings.
- Collaborate cross-functionally with sales, operations, and manufacturing to support customer demands and project schedules.
- Manage relationships with third-party logistics providers and transportation vendors.
- Oversee maintenance of distribution equipment and facilities to ensure operational readiness.
- Prepare reports and provide regular updates to senior leadership on distribution performance and challenges.
- It is an essential function of this job that the employee regularly and reliably reports to work on time each working day.
- Perform other duties as necessary or assigned.
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Supply Chain Management, Logistics, Business Administration, or a related field preferred.
- Minimum 3 years of experience in distribution, warehouse management, or logistics, preferably in construction materials or related industries.
- Proven leadership skills with experience managing teams in a fast-paced distribution environment.
- Strong knowledge of inventory management, logistics, and transportation best practices.
- Proficiency with warehouse management systems (WMS), ERP software, and Microsoft Office Suite.
- Excellent organ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ills.
- Ability to work collaboratively across departments and with external partners.
- Commitment to safety, quality, and continuous improvement.
- Experience with foundation repair or construction supply chains is a plus.
- Willingness to occasionally travel to distribution centers, branch locations, or supplier sites.
Working Conditions
- Primarily based in a distribution center or regional office with standard business hours; may require occasional extended hours to meet operational needs.
- Work environment includes warehouse and loading dock areas with adherence to safety protocols.
- Use of computers, handheld scanners, and warehouse technology integral to daily tasks.
- Fast-paced, physically active environment requiring multitasking and strong organizational skills.
- Occasional travel to Groundworks branches, manufacturing facilities, or supplier locations.

Verify E-Verify enrollment before accepting offers
Your 24-month STEM OPT extension requires your employer to be enrolled in E-Verify. Confirm Groundworks's E-Verify status through the official E-Verify employer search before signing any offer letter. Discovering a gap after your 12-month OPT starts costs you extension eligibility.

Request a written sponsorship timeline in the offer stage
OPT work authorization has fixed windows. When you receive an offer, ask HR directly whether the company has sponsored H-1B for employees who started on OPT and what that transition timeline looks like. Getting this in writing before you accept protects you if your hiring manager changes.
Check prevailing wage for your target role and location
Groundworks operates across multiple states, and prevailing wage rates vary by region and occupation. Use the OFLC Wage Search to look up wage levels for your specific role before negotiating your offer. Coming in below the prevailing wage for your area creates problems if you later pursue H-1B sponsorship.

Does Groundworks sponsor OPT visas?
Groundworks hires students who already hold OPT work authorization granted by USCIS. The company doesn't sponsor OPT itself since OPT is tied to your F-1 status, not an employer petition. What matters is that Groundworks hires OPT students and has infrastructure for work authorization compliance, including E-Verify enrollment for STEM OPT eligibility.

How do I confirm Groundworks supports STEM OPT extension?
STEM OPT requires your employer to be enrolled in E-Verify. You can verify Groundworks's enrollment status through the official E-Verify employer search tool before accepting an offer. Your DSO also needs to authorize the extension, so confirm your degree's STEM designation with your international student office early in the offer negotiation process.
